Loomly vs Restream: In-Depth Analysis
Positioning: Social Media Management vs. Live Streaming
Loomly and Restream serve distinctly different purposes within the digital content ecosystem. Loomly functions as a comprehensive brand success platform designed to streamline social media management across multiple channels, offering tools for scheduling, content planning, and audience engagement tracking. Restream, conversely, specializes in simultaneous multistreaming to over 30 platforms at once, making it the ideal solution for content creators and broadcasters who need to reach audiences across fragmented video platforms without managing separate streams. While Loomly focuses on post-publication analytics and team collaboration, Restream prioritizes real-time broadcasting capabilities and cross-platform reach.
Pricing and Value Proposition
The pricing structures reveal different target markets. Loomly starts at $32 per month with no free tier, positioning itself toward serious social media teams willing to invest in comprehensive management tools. The per-channel pricing model means costs scale with the number of platforms you manage, which can become expensive for brands juggling six or more social accounts. Restream enters at $16 monthly and includes a generous free plan, making it accessible for independent streamers and small creators testing the platform before committing financially. This freemium approach gives Restream a clear advantage for budget-conscious users or those wanting to evaluate features before purchase.
Distinct Strengths and User Satisfaction
Loomly's 4.6/5 rating from 151 reviews reflects strong user satisfaction with its engagement analytics, content calendar views, and multi-platform scheduling capabilities. Teams particularly value the platform's ability to maintain brand consistency across channels and track audience interaction metrics. Restream's 4.3/5 rating across 186 reviews highlights appreciation for HD video and audio quality alongside its ability to broadcast simultaneously to dozens of platforms. However, Restream users acknowledge that call quality depends heavily on internet connection strength, and the free plan comes with meaningful feature limitations compared to paid tiers.
Choosing Between Them
Select Loomly if your priority is managing organic social media content, building audience engagement, and coordinating team workflows across platforms like Instagram, Facebook, and TikTok. The deeper analytics and content planning tools justify the higher price for marketing teams focused on strategic brand building. Choose Restream if you're a content creator, podcaster, or broadcaster who needs to simultaneously deliver live video to multiple platforms while minimizing technical complexity. The free plan allows immediate testing, and the lower entry price makes it ideal for individual creators or agencies managing numerous client streams.
